Stamford Hill station doesn't have a ticket office, but there are ticket machines available for your convenience. These machines can be used to purchase and collect tickets, including those bought online, ensuring your journey starts smoothly. They are accessible to all customers, including those with disabilities. The station also supports basic customer assistance via an information point and has staff on hand for help during most hours of the week. CCTV is operational for security, although there is no lost property office outside the standard workweek hours.
For those seeking a digital edge, the station provides public Wi-Fi. There are no refreshment or shopping facilities onsite, so it might be wise to grab that coffee and snack before arriving. Though the station lacks certain facilities, like a waiting room or accessible toilets, it ensures a basic level of comfort with seating areas and helpful signage to assist travelers with disabilities.

Stamford Hill Station has made strides in accessibility, ensuring accessible ticket machines and an induction loop for those who are hearing impaired. Assistance staff are available daily, catering to the needs of passengers with various mobility constraints. However, it lacks step-free access and doesn’t offer wheelchairs or ramps, so it’s good to plan ahead if you require additional assistance.

For those looking to purchase tickets at Dorking West, it's important to note that there is no ticket office or ticket machine on-site. Passengers are encouraged to buy tickets ahead of their journey either through online platforms or mobile apps. Despite the lack of ticketing facilities, travelers will find help points throughout the station, offering useful information and departure screens to keep you updated on train services.
When it comes to accessibility, Dorking West shines with step-free access available to both platforms, even though access between them requires using a subway or road bridge. Facilities for the disabled include induction loops and ramps for train access, ensuring everyone has the support they need to embark on their journey. However, there are no toilets, baby-changing facilities, or waiting rooms available, so plan your visit accordingly. Though there is no CCTV, the station provides a seating area should you need to relax before your trip.
For cyclists, Dorking West offers 20 sheltered bicycle spaces on both platforms—allowing you to cycle to the station and continue your journey by train. It's a fantastic way to enjoy the lush surrounding countryside before or after your ride.

While there isn't a taxi rank at the station, alternative arrangements are easily available. For those needing a rail replacement service, you can head to the Railway Bridge on Ranmore Road.
There's also a gateway link for airport transfers. To connect to major airports, you can change at Reading for both Heathrow and Gatwick links, or at Bristol Temple Meads for Bristol Airport.
